James L. Rubart

24 books

400 pages 2010

fiction fantasy mysterious reflective fast-paced

388 pages 2011

fiction fantasy mysterious tense fast-paced

400 pages 2015

fiction contemporary reflective medium-paced

1075 pages 2012

fiction speculative fiction emotional reflective fast-paced

380 pages 2016

fiction contemporary fantasy emotional reflective fast-paced

384 pages 2018

fiction contemporary thriller reflective fast-paced

230 pages paperback

nonfiction religion informative reflective medium-paced

369 pages 2019

fiction contemporary emotional reflective slow-paced

385 pages 2010

fiction mystery mysterious reflective medium-paced

381 pages 2012

fiction fantasy adventurous informative reflective slow-paced